Description

Under the supervision of the production director, the supervisor ensures that employees under their responsibility produce safely and efficiently according to established quality standards, while respecting standard costs and delivery deadlines.

What Will Your Days Be Like?

  • Ensure the application of the collective agreement and SST regulations while contributing to maintaining good working relationships.
  • Act as the main supporter of the safety process to support the company's SST culture.
  • Monitor health and safety and productivity indicators.
  • Supervise a team of approximately 20 employees, distributed across three different departments.
  • Monitor performance and quality indicators.
  • Validate the time cards of employees under your supervision.
  • Plan and organize production to meet delivery deadlines, quality standards, and productivity goals, providing technical support to employees.
  • Manage unexpected replacements.
  • Ensure effective management of absenteeism and discipline.
  • Lead weekly and daily meetings at the dashboard with employees.
  • Participate in continuous improvement projects using tools such as Kaizen, SMED, and 5S.

What Are the Job Requirements?

  • Knowledge of ISO 9001 and 14001 standards.
  • Ability to work under pressure and make decisions.
  • Demonstrate rigor, organization, autonomy, and resourcefulness.
  • Ability to communicate effectively and tactfully to be recognized as a mobilizer within the work team.
  • Hold a college diploma in industrial management, industrial engineering, or administration (an asset).
  • Have 3 to 5 years of experience in supervision, in a unionized manufacturing environment.
  • Have experience using Kaizen, 5S, and SMED (important asset).
